Abstract

The invention provides an electric girdling knife which comprises a knife support, a knife component, a first handle, a butting component, a second handle and a driving component, wherein the knife support is fixedly connected with the knife component; the cutter support is of a U-shaped structure; the cutter component is arranged in the cutter bracket, is rotatably connected with the cutter bracket and is used for cutting barks; one end of the first handle is connected with the bottom of the cutter bracket, and the other end of the first handle is used for holding; one side of the abutting part is provided with an arc-shaped groove used for abutting against the branch to be girdled; one end of the second handle is connected with one end of the abutting piece, the other end of the second handle is used for holding, and the middle part of the second handle is crossed with the middle part of the first handle and is connected with the first handle in a rotating mode; and the driving component is arranged on the cutter bracket and used for driving the cutter component to rotate to cut the barks. The electric girdling knife provided by the invention has the advantages of low labor intensity and higher working efficiency.

Description

Electric ring stripping knife
Technical Field
The invention belongs to the technical field of tree girdling, and particularly relates to an electric girdling knife.
Background
The girdling is that the fruit tree is in the growth period, uses two knives on the branch to girdling with the sword, peels off the bark between two edges of a knife, exposes xylem to temporarily interrupt the downward transportation of organic matter, reduces the nutrition that supplies the root system, increases the accumulation of carbohydrate, endogenous hormone ethylene, abscisic acid of the position above the girdling mouth, thereby inhibits the vegetative growth of the position above the girdling mouth, promotes reproductive growth, in order to reach the effect of promoting flowers, protecting fruits, strengthening fruits, accelerating maturity and increasing sugar, and the girdling device is the device that girdling is carried out to the fruit tree bark.
Most of the existing girdling devices are manual girdling devices, the manual force is needed to girdling the barks of fruit trees, and workers usually need to girdling the barks of the fruit trees continuously for a plurality of days, so that the labor intensity is high, and the working efficiency is low.

Detailed Description
In order to make the technical problems, technical solutions and advantageous effects to be solved by the present invention more clearly apparent, the present invention is further described in detail below with reference to the accompanying drawings and embodiments. It should be understood that the specific embodiments described herein are merely illustrative of the invention and are not intended to limit the invention.
Referring to fig. 1 and 6 together, the electric girdling knife of the present invention will now be described. The electric ring stripping knife comprises a knife bracket 10, a knife assembly, a first handle 11, a butting piece 12, a second handle 13 and a driving assembly; the cutter support 10 is of a U-shaped structure, and the cutter support 10 is provided with a cutter support base; a cutter assembly provided in the cutter holder 10, rotatably connected to the cutter holder 10, for cutting bark; a first handle 11 having one end connected to the bottom of the tool holder 10 and the other end for holding; an arc-shaped groove is arranged on one side of the abutting piece 12 and is used for abutting against the branch to be girdled; one end of the second handle 13 is connected with one end of the abutting piece 12, the other end of the second handle is used for holding, and the middle part of the second handle 13 is crossed with the middle part of the first handle 11 and is connected with the first handle in a rotating mode; and a driving assembly provided on the cutter holder 10 for driving the cutter assembly to rotate to cut the bark.
When the tool is used, the driving component is started to drive the tool component to rotate; simultaneously holding one end of the first handle 11 and one end of the second handle 13 to enable the first handle and the second handle to be close together, wherein the abutting piece 12 abuts against one side of the surface of the tree, the cutter component abuts against the other side of the surface, and the bark at the contact part is cut; then, the holding state is kept, so that the electric girdling knife moves around the circumference of the tree, and the girdling of the tree bark is completed.
The electric girdling knife has the advantages that compared with the prior art, the electric girdling knife provided by the embodiment is provided with the knife bracket 10, the knife assembly is rotatably connected to the knife bracket 10, and the knife bracket 10 is also provided with the driving assembly for driving the knife assembly to rotate so as to cut barks; and still be equipped with first handle 11, second handle 13 and butt piece 12, first handle 11 one end is connected with the bottom of cutter support 10, the other end is used for gripping, butt piece 12 one side is equipped with the arc recess, be used for with waiting to encircle the branch butt, second handle 13 one end is connected with the one end of butt piece 12, the other end is used for gripping, the middle part of second handle 13 and the middle part of first handle 11 are criss-cross and rotate the connection, grip the one end of first handle 11 and second handle 13 simultaneously, make it close together, at this moment, butt piece 12 butt is in trees surface one side, cutter unit butt is in the surperficial opposite side, change the interval of first handle 11 and second handle 13 one end, can make the electronic girdling sword adapt to the trees of different diameters.
Referring to fig. 1 to 3 together, as a specific embodiment of the electric ring barking knife provided by the invention, the knife assembly includes a first mounting plate 20, a second mounting plate 21 and a plurality of blade assemblies 25, the first mounting plate 20 and the second mounting plate 21 are both circular structures, a connection line of a circle center of the first mounting plate 20 and a circle center of the second mounting plate 21 is perpendicular to the first mounting plate 20 and the second mounting plate 21, and one end of each group of blade assemblies 25 is connected with the first mounting plate 20, and the other end is connected with the second mounting plate 21.
It should be noted that, the plurality of blade assemblies 25 are preferably 10 groups, the diameters of the first mounting plate 20 and the second mounting plate 21 are the same, when bark is girdled, the first mounting plate 20 and the second mounting plate 21 abut against the bark, the plurality of blade assemblies 25 are uniformly arranged around the center of the first mounting plate 20, one ends of the plurality of blade assemblies 25 are arranged on the radial outer sides of the first mounting plate 20 and the second mounting plate 21, the bark is cut along with the rotation of the cutter assembly, and the radial distance between the end of the blade assembly 25 arranged on the outer sides of the first mounting plate 20 and the second mounting plate 21 and the edges of the first mounting plate 20 and the second mounting plate 21 is the girdling depth of the bark girdling by the cutter assembly.
Referring to fig. 3 to 4 together, as one embodiment of the electric ring barking knife provided by the invention, the knife assembly further includes a first connecting ring 22, a second connecting ring 23 and an adjusting rod 24, and each set of blade assemblies 25 includes a blade 251, a connecting plate 252, a first connecting shaft 253, a second connecting shaft 254, a first blade holder 255 and a second blade holder 256; the first connecting ring 22 side abuts against the first mounting plate 20, and the second connecting ring 23 side abuts against the second mounting plate 21; one end of the first connection shaft 253 is rotatably connected with the first connection ring 22, and the other end is rotatably connected with the second connection ring 23; one end of the second connecting shaft 254 is rotatably connected with the first mounting plate 20, and the other end is rotatably connected with the second mounting plate 21; the second connecting shaft 254 is staggered from the circle centers of the first mounting plate 20 and the second mounting plate 21, and the radial distance between the first connecting shaft 253 and the circle center of the first mounting plate 20 or the second mounting plate 21 is larger than the radial distance between the second connecting shaft 254 and the circle center of the first mounting plate 20 or the second mounting plate 21; one end of each of the connecting plate 252 and the blade 251 is rotatably connected to a first connecting shaft 253, the other end of the connecting plate 252 is rotatably connected to a second connecting shaft 254, and the other end of the blade 251 is used for cutting bark; one side of the blade 251 is slidably connected with the first blade support 255, the first blade support 255 is rotatably connected with the first mounting plate 20, the other side of the blade 251 is slidably connected with the second blade support 256, and the second blade support 256 is rotatably connected with the second mounting plate 21; the first mounting plate 20 is provided with an adjusting hole 201, one end of the adjusting rod 24 is connected with the first connecting ring 22, and the other end is disposed in the adjusting hole 201.
It should be noted that the first blade holder 255 includes a first receiving plate and a first holder rotating shaft 50, a first sliding slot is disposed on one side of the first receiving plate, one end of the blade 251 is clamped in the first sliding slot and has a degree of freedom for sliding in the extending direction of the first sliding slot, one end of the first holder rotating shaft 50 is fixedly connected to the other side of the first receiving plate, and the other end is rotatably connected to the first mounting plate 20; the second blade support 256 includes a second support plate and a second support shaft 50, a second sliding slot is disposed on one side of the second support plate, one end of the blade 251 is clamped in the second sliding slot and has a sliding degree of freedom in the extending direction of the second sliding slot, one end of the second support shaft 50 is fixedly connected with the other side of the second support plate, the other end of the second support shaft is rotatably connected with the second mounting plate 21, and the axes of the first support shaft 50 and the second support shaft 50 coincide.
It should be understood that, by moving the adjusting rod 24 along the circumference of the first mounting plate 20, the connecting plate 252 can rotate around the second connecting shaft 254, the blade 251 can rotate around the first connecting shaft 253 relative to the connecting plate 252 while sliding relative to the first blade support 255 and the second blade support 256 and rotating around the first support rotating shaft 50 or the second support rotating shaft 50, and the length of the adjusting blade extending out of the first mounting plate 20 and the second mounting plate 21, that is, the girdling depth of the electric girdling is adjusted, so as to meet the requirements of different trees on girdling depth.
Connecting all the blade assemblies together by the first and second connecting rings so as to synchronously adjust the length of all the blades extending out of the first and second mounting plates 20 and 21; blade 251 and connecting plate 252 are the contained angle setting, are favorable to collecting the saw-dust, are that the saw-dust can be preserved in the cavity that first mounting panel 20, second mounting panel 21 and many dry blade subassembly 25 formed, avoid the saw-dust to splash.
Referring to fig. 2 and 6, as an embodiment of the electric ring-type peeling knife of the present invention, the other end of the adjusting rod 24 is disposed in the first mounting plate 20 and has a driving groove 241.
It should be noted that the other end of the adjusting rod 24 is disposed in the first mounting plate 20 to avoid the adjusting rod 24 colliding with the cutter holder 10 when the adjusting rod 24 rotates with the cutter assembly; when the adjusting rod 24 needs to be pulled to adjust the girdling depth, other objects need to be inserted into the driving groove 241, and then the adjusting rod 24 is pulled to adjust the extending length of the blade.
Referring to fig. 1 to 5, as an embodiment of the electric ring barking knife of the present invention, the knife assembly further includes a limit screw 26 and a scale 27, the limit screw 26 passes through the first mounting plate 20 and abuts against the first connecting ring 22, the scale 27 is disposed at one side of the adjusting hole 201 for displaying the length of the blade 251 extending out of the first mounting plate 20.
It should be understood that the number of the limit screws 26 may be multiple, the limit screws 26 are in threaded connection with the first mounting plate 20 and penetrate through the first mounting plate 20 to abut against the first connecting ring 22, when the girdling depth needs to be adjusted, the limit screws 26 are unscrewed, the adjusting rods 24 are pulled, the dial 27 displays the girdling depth corresponding to the position of the adjusting rods 24 at this time, and after the adjustment is completed, the limit screws 26 are screwed down to prevent the girdling depth from changing in the working process.
Referring to fig. 1 to 3, as an embodiment of the electric ring-type peeling knife provided by the invention, the knife assembly further includes a first connecting cylinder 28 and a second connecting cylinder 29, one end of the first connecting cylinder 28 is fixedly connected to the first mounting plate 20, the other end is rotatably connected to one side of the knife holder 10, one end of the second connecting cylinder 29 is fixedly connected to the second mounting plate 21, and the other end is rotatably connected to the other side of the knife holder 10.
Referring to fig. 1 to 2, as an embodiment of the electric girdling knife provided by the invention, the electric girdling knife further includes a wood chip storage bottle 30, a second mounting plate 21 is provided with a chip removal hole 211 along an axial direction, a diameter of the chip removal hole 211 is not larger than an inner diameter of the second connecting cylinder 29 and is communicated with the second connecting cylinder 29, and a mouth of the wood chip storage bottle 30 is connected and communicated with the second connecting cylinder 29.
It should be noted that, when trees are girdled, the wood chips enter the cavity formed by the first mounting plate 20, the second mounting plate 21 and the multi-trunk blade assemblies 25 along the gaps among the blade assemblies 25 and enter the wood chip storage bottle 30 from the chip discharge holes 211, so that the wood chips are prevented from splashing, blocking the equipment and even flying into eyes of people, damaging the equipment and harming the health of the people.
Referring to fig. 1 to 3, as an embodiment of the electric ring-peeling knife provided by the present invention, the electric ring-peeling knife further includes a fan assembly, the first mounting plate 20 is provided with a plurality of ventilation holes 202 along an axial direction, the plurality of ventilation holes 202 are all communicated with the first connecting cylinder 28, the fan assembly is disposed in the first connecting cylinder 28, one end of the fan assembly is rotatably connected with the first mounting plate 20, the other end of the fan assembly is connected with the driving assembly for blowing the wood chips in the cutter assembly into the wood chip storage bottle 30, and the bottle bottom of the wood chip storage bottle 30 is a dense net structure.
Set up ventilation hole 202 on first mounting panel 20 to installation fan unit, blow to one side of second mounting panel 21 through drive fan unit, make the saw-dust more fast more abundant enter into saw-dust storage bottle 30 in, avoid the saw-dust to splash, jam equipment flies into people's eyes even, damage equipment, harm healthy, establish the bottle end of saw-dust storage bottle 30 into intensive network structure, in order to guarantee the circulation of air, avoid saw-dust storage bottle 30 internal pressure to be greater than the bottle external pressure, and make the saw-dust can not get into in the saw-dust storage bottle 30 smoothly.
Referring to fig. 1 to 3 together, as a specific embodiment of the electric ring barking knife provided by the invention, the driving assembly includes a mounting bracket 40, a driving motor 41 and a first gear 42, and the fan assembly includes a rotating shaft 50, a plurality of fan blades 51 and a second gear 52; one end of the rotating shaft 50 is rotatably connected with the first mounting plate 20, the other end of the rotating shaft is rotatably connected with the mounting frame 40, one uniform end of each of the plurality of fan blades 51 is connected with the rotating shaft 50, and the second gear 52 is arranged between the fan blades 51 and the mounting frame 40 and fixedly connected with the rotating shaft 50; the inner wall periphery of the first connecting cylinder 28 is provided with structural teeth, the mounting frame 40 is connected with the first mounting plate 20, the driving motor 41 is arranged on the mounting frame, and the first gear 42 is fixedly connected with the driving shaft of the driving motor 41 and is meshed with the second gear 52 and the second connecting cylinder 29 simultaneously.
It should be understood that the first gear 42 is located between the second gear 52 and the inner wall of the first connecting cylinder 28, and is meshed with the second gear 52 and the second connecting cylinder 29, and when the cutter assembly is driven to rotate, the fan assembly is driven to rotate, at this time, the rotating direction of the fan assembly is opposite to that of the cutter assembly, the rotating speed of the fan assembly relative to the cutter assembly is faster, the generated wind power is larger, the sawdust can enter the sawdust storage bottle 30 more sufficiently, the sawdust is prevented from splashing, the blocked device can fly into eyes of people, the device is damaged, and the health of people is harmed.
Referring to fig. 1, as an embodiment of the electric girdling knife provided by the invention, the electric girdling knife further includes a battery 60, a battery accommodating cavity is formed in the first handle 11 or the second handle 13, and the battery 60 is disposed in the battery accommodating cavity and electrically connected to the driving assembly.
Set up the battery and hold the chamber in first handle 11 or second handle 13 is inside, establish battery 60 in the battery holds the intracavity to more abundant space of utilizing, conveniently carry with the volume that reduces electronic ring broach, directly establish the power on electronic ring broach simultaneously, can not produce extra connecting wire, it is lower to the space requirement during the ring is shelled, convenient operation.
